Esther Anatolitis

Esther Anatolitis is the editor of Meanjin, honorary associate professor at RMIT School of Art and a member of the National Gallery of Australia Governing Council. She is the author of Place, Practice, Politics (2021) and editor of the anthology Essays that Changed Australia: Meanjin 1940 to today (2023). Her latest book, When Australia Became a Republic, will be published later this year.
